I don't think this has been posted yet (if it has, sorry for the re-post).

BMWCCA's LA Chapter has organized a tour of BMW's Vehicle Distribution Center (VDC) in Oxnard, CA on Saturday NOV. 3, 2007. I went to the one two years ago and it was pretty interesting. It costs $12 per person and you have to either be a BMWCCA or Mini owners club member to attend, or come with a friend who is one. They also, serve lunch after the tour......last time it was a BBQ lunch.

Here are a couple of links to the Information/application form. The first is a pdf file and the second is a Word file (you can't register online, you have to actually send the form with a check to them):
